2025 CEV Cup, Trentino Itas secures victory in Lisbon in the first leg of the round of 16

The first match in its nearly 25-year history on Portuguese soil gave Trentino Volley the result it needed to approach its immediate future (the Club World Championship in Brazil and the second leg in Sardinia) with confidence and high ambitions. This evening in Lisbon, the reigning European Champions claimed a decisive 3-0 victory against hosts Sport Lisboa e Benfica in the first leg of the 2025 CEV Cup Round of 16, taking a significant step towards qualifying for the next stage.
To complete their mission, the gialloblù need only win two sets in the return match, scheduled at PalaPirastu in Cagliari on Thursday, December 19. Trentino Itas earned this critical advantage over the two-leg series with a solid, mistake-free performance, showcasing their ability to approach the match with the right mindset while quickly bouncing back from Sunday night’s defeat in Civitanova Marche.                               Key factors in the victory included a sharp serving game from the outset, high-quality high-ball attacks, and an improving block that delivered seven points in the third set alone. These tools helped neutralize the hosts’ attempts to stay competitive. In every set, Trentino Itas started stronger than Benfica and managed to hold off their comebacks, leveraging stellar performances from Michieletto in the first set (five of his 12 points came in this period), Rychlicki in the second (six points), and Flavio in the third. The Brazilian middle blocker was the standout player, contributing seven winning points in the final set, including three blocks (and four total in the match). Lavia also reached double digits, scoring ten crucial points at pivotal moments. 

Below is the scoreboard of the first leg of the round of 16 of the 2025 CEV Cup, played this evening at Sports Hall Benfica in Lisbon.

Sport Lisboa e Benfica-Trentino Itas 0-3
(20-25, 23-25, 19-25)
SPORT LISBOA E BENFICA: Da Silva Violas 1, Nivaldo Nadhir 14, Eshenko 10, Banderò 8, Wohlfahrtstaetter 2, Ryuma Oto Aleixo 9, Casas (L); Ventura Machado, Leitao, Godlewski. N.e. Bernardo, Brito, Teixeira, Fernandes. All. Marcel Matz.
TRENTINO ITAS: Pellacani 4, Sbertoli 2, Lavia 10, Flavio 9, Rychlicki 8, Michieletto 12, Laurenzano (L); Gabi Garcia, Bartha 2, Magalini 2. N.e. Bristot, Pesaresi, Acquarone. All. Fabio Soli.
REFEREES: Souto Jimenez from Mallorca (Spain) e Oravainen from Lapinlahti (Finland).
SETS’ DURATION: 25’, 30’, 26’; tot 1h 21’.
MORE INFO: 926 spectators. Sport Lisboa e Benfica: 3 blocks, 1 ace, 16 serve errors, 9 attack errors, 43% in attack, 33% (20%) in serve. Itas Trentino: 9 blocks, 3 ace, 10 serve errors, 7 attack errors, 44% in attack, 53% (21%) in serve.
